This EFL Championship 2024-25 fixture take us to the Stadium of Light where Sunderland AFC are set to host Norwich City FC.
Sunderland AFC, once the dominant force in the EFL Championship this season, find themselves in an unexpected fourth position after a series of inconsistent performances. Having relinquished their earlier momentum, the team will be keen to capitalize on their home advantage as they prepare to face Norwich City FC in a crucial encounter.
In their last five fixtures, Sunderland have managed only two wins and two draws, along with a solitary defeat, a run that has undoubtedly disrupted their rhythm. However, their recent 3-2 victory over Swansea City offered a glimpse of their attacking prowess and fighting spirit. With the race for promotion tightening, Sunderland will aim to seize this opportunity and secure all three points, knowing that any further slip-ups could prove costly in their campaign. Their ability to respond under pressure and leverage the home crowd’s energy could be decisive against a resilient Norwich side.
Norwich City FC, in stark contrast, are languishing in the lower half of the Championship table, having managed to accumulate only 26 points from 21 matches. Their recent run of form has been disappointing, with no wins in their last three outings. Defeats to QPR and Burnley, followed by a goalless stalemate against Portsmouth, have further dampened their campaign.
Despite these setbacks, Norwich will be desperate to overturn their fortunes and put on a resilient performance. Securing a positive result in this fixture could serve as a turning point for the Canaries, as they seek to regain confidence and climb the league standings. The challenge of facing a strong side will demand a collective effort and a marked improvement in both their defensive and attacking displays.

Players to watch out for:
Patrick Roberts (Sunderland)
Patrick John Joseph Roberts, the 27-year-old English winger hailing from Kingston, has enjoyed a dynamic footballing journey, showcasing his talents across various clubs. Beginning his professional career at Fulham, Roberts caught the attention of Manchester City, subsequently embarking on a series of loan spells with notable sides like Celtic, Norwich City, Middlesbrough, and Girona. In 2022, he found a new home at Sunderland AFC, where he has since made over 100 appearances, contributing eight goals to the club’s endeavours.
Anis Ben Slimane (Norwich)
Anis Ben Slimane, the 23-year-old Danish-born midfielder from Copenhagen, has carved a promising footballing journey, beginning with clubs like Brøndby and Sheffield United before currently plying his trade on loan at Norwich City. A versatile and technically gifted player, Slimane’s current stint with Norwich City offers him a platform to showcase his talents in the demanding environment of the EFL Championship.

Injuries and Team News:
Sunderland’s list of absentees includes Jenson Seelt and Salis Samed.
Norwich will most likely miss the presence of Josh Sargent and Liam Gibbs in the upcoming match.
Head To Head stats:
Total matches – 59
Sunderland won – 20
Norwich won – 24
Matches drawn – 15
